Easy walk to the Plaza, Rail Station, galleries, and resturants, from this beautiful,1850 SqFt,three bedroom/two full bath, tastefully decorated throughout with original art work, adobe-style home in South Capital area. Grounds are heavily treed and private. Rail Yard has a large new development of shops, galleries and resturants includings Tomasita's where the Railrunner from Albuquerque arrives and departs several times daily.

It has Santa Fe charm and coziness while accommodating six without crowding.


Enjoy the cool comfort of this fully air conditioned home.
Two phone lines for the computer literate. High speed internet.
Three new HDTV's.

Why the Owner Chose Private Homes, Historical Downtown

Santa Fe is rightfully called the "City Different". There are not many places within the United States that you can taste a true difference in the normally homogenious culture we have throughout our country. Santa Fe provides that plus opera, theatre, shopping, wonderful food, hiking, golfing, history, and fine dining. Our home is located right in town which makes everything mentioned only minutes away.

The Unique Benefits at this House

Our home is totally turn key. Since it is our second home, all you need to bring are your clothes and food. We are a short walk to Trader Joe's, Whole Foods, the Farmer's Market, galleries, restaurants and the new Railrunner light rail connecting to Albuquerque. The walk to the Plaza is about 7/10ths of a mile. Our home is tastefully furnished with nice furniture, lovely art and some Indian Market award winning pieces. For anyone that enjoys cooking, the kitchen has everything needed for even the most discriminating cook. There is a gas grill right outside the kitchen.

We bought our home in Santa Fe when we living over seas in Kuala Lumpur, Maylasia. Jim was working for Texaco and we needed a home to return to for long holiday periods and it was the first chance we had ever had to own something in a place that we loved. Jim retired in 1999 and we now live in Denver. Since Santa Fe is so centrally located in the U. S., it gives us a chance to enjoy our own home as our time permits. We still are working in Denver for RE/MAX as very active real estate agents.
